~ Wednesday, March 13 ~

I woke up pretty early the next morning. Something woke me up around 4 and I couldn't get back to sleep, try as I might. I finally got up at 5:30 and headed for the shower. The way it worked all week was that I would set my alarm and get up first to shower. Then I'd wake up Chuck and the boys.

We'd brought along bagels and peanut butter along with the oatmeal. I can't remember which we had this morning, but it was probably the bagels. Chuck packed his small backpack with necessary items such as Lara bars (these are granola bars that contain all natural ingredients--very tasty and filling, but also expensive) and bottles of water. We were out the door and heading to the bus stop by 7 (which was my goal).

As a reference for those who might stay at The Fort and want to plan for using the buses, my notes say we got on a boat at 7:30. And I know we waited a little bit at the dock. Here is our gorgeous view that morning:

The boat stopped at Wilderness Lodge. It was the only time it did this on our trip. Not quite sure why it did. We ended up arriving at MK just before the opening show started. I was glad we'd purchased our tickets the night before or else we would have missed it.

With the park officially opened, we headed inside. Doing what we decided to call "The Disney Shuffle." Y'all know what this is, right? When crowds are heavy you kind of have to shuffle along. We did our Disney Shuffle dance throughout the trip, even when the crowds weren't bad. :dance3:

Since my boys weren't interested in any of the new Fantasyland stuff (or most of the old except for Goofy's Barnstormer), we headed to Big Thunder Mountain Railroad. Chuck, Owen and Connor had never done this one before so it was high on our list. There was no wait of course. Everyone liked it although Connor rode most of the time with his eyes closed.

Next we headed to Haunted Mansion. Again, only Sully and I had done this one before. Everyone enjoyed this one too.

It was time for a snack break so we got out the Lara bars, trail mix, and water. Then we headed to Carousel of Progress. I was the only one who'd done this one before. And of course throughout the show, I joined in every time. "It's a GREAT big beautiful tomorrow--shining at the end of every day."

Connor wanted to do the People Mover next so we got on for a ride. I'd forgotten how fast it went. I think it was Connor's favorite ride of the day!

I forgot to mention that when we first entered the park, we went over to the firestation to get Sorcerer of the Magic Kingdom cards, but they said the machine was down or something and we should go to the kiosk behind the Christmas Shop. So after the People Mover, we headed that way.

We headed off to find our first location, but couldn't get it to work. So we went back to the kiosk where we started and they changed the location for us. (Turns out, we'd actually been at the wrong one.) We did a couple and then couldn't find the next one. (Again, we were confused looking at the map they gave us and were looking in the wrong spot.) We decided to give up for now and head over to see some Pirates. It'd been a while since we'd done Pirates of the Caribbean. After a nice boat ride, it was time for some lunch. Originally I'd wanted to try Be Our Guest. But given the time and our location (and the fact their menu is kind of limited and not a lot the kids would like), we decided to just hit Pecos Bills. It was pretty crowded in there but we managed to find a nice table outside. I enjoyed my taco salad. :thumbsup2
